When users upload photos, the Scrubwell service strips EXIF metadata — GPS coordinates, device model, timestamps — before anything reaches storage. If a customer reports location data leaking, first confirm the upload actually passed through Scrubwell; direct-to-bucket uploads from legacy clients bypass it, and those tickets escalate to Tier 2. You can verify a file's scrub status through the Scrubwell inspection endpoint in the support console. Authenticate your inspection requests with the credential provided below.

API key for haduf-tageg: vxb2-d8

Handover — Ben to Carla. Intern cohort from the Sablehurst programme arrives Monday, twelve of them, based on level 2 of Orrinvale House. Contractors: expect congestion at the main turnstiles 8:30–9:30 all week, use the east entrance instead. Interns get temporary lanyards from reception; they can't escort anyone, including you. Hot-desk zone near the lab is off-limits until Thursday. If the east entrance reader is down, the fallback door code is below.

staff pass of kawip-hawef = bdg-QLP-2

TICKET-4412: Expired credentials blocking blue-green cutover

The Fenwick billing worker failed its green-slot health check this morning because the service account credential for the internal ledger API expired over the weekend. Blue is still serving on the old key, which remains valid for another 48 hours, so billing runs are unaffected for now. A replacement key has been issued by the platform team and should be applied to both slots before the next deploy window. The new key follows.

service key, fawip-bajef: kto11_Qt5wZK9vdNC

## Break-Glass: Flaky Integration Tests (Tollgate Payments)

Hey, welcome aboard! Sometimes the Tollgate payments test suite wedges the sandbox ledger and reruns won't help. Don't panic — that's what break-glass is for. Ping whoever's on rotation first, but if nobody answers in 15 minutes, you're cleared to reset the sandbox yourself. Log what you did in the runbook afterward. The passphrase you'll need is right here.

unlock words, yawig-kagef: gordor-holvan-ulaael-pramir-ulaiel-tamdor